Handover note — Crumbwheel order cutoffs.

Welcome aboard. The bakery cutoff rule in Crumbwheel closes same-day orders at 14:00 local to each storefront, not UTC — this has bitten us twice. Holiday overrides live in the calendar service and take precedence silently, so always check there first when a cutoff looks wrong. To unlock the calendar service's admin console after a restart, enter the recovery passphrase below.

vault phrase of bagap-bahaf = silion-pelox-sorox-casdor-quenwyn-fraax-eliox-praael-kelion-quenvan-kasox-rusael-norius-belvan

# Env Vars: Planner Regression Mitigation

After the query planner regression in Corvid DB 9.3, Fernwell's release builds must pin the legacy planner until the patched build ships. Set `CORVID_PLANNER_MODE=legacy` in the release env file and confirm it with the preflight check before tagging. The planner override endpoint requires authentication, so the release env file also needs the planner override token on the next line.

env line for kahof-fajeg: ARCHIVE_KEY3=397

## Extraction endpoint

Plugin authors integrating with the Phraselift extractor call the `/extract` endpoint with a manifest listing source globs. The service scans matched files, returns candidate strings as JSON, and dedupes against the central catalog. Rate limit: 60 requests per minute. Responses are cached for ten minutes per manifest hash. All calls to the internal extraction service must authenticate with the key provided below.

app token of bawep-hafog = kto7_vwrmnlx

# Break-Glass: Catalog Cache Invalidation

Scope: the Pinrow product catalog at Veldstone Retail. If stale prices persist after a purge and the Hollowmere invalidation queue is wedged, use break-glass to flush the edge tier directly. Contractors: get verbal sign-off from the catalog lead first. Steps: open the Hollowmere admin shell, select emergency-flush, confirm the tenant, and run it once — repeated flushes thrash the origin. Access is logged and expires after 20 minutes. Unseal the admin shell with the passphrase below.

recovery phrase for kahop-tajog: istix-casvan